On Fri, 10 Jan 2025 at 16:02,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<philmd@linaro.org> wrote: > > There is nothing mapped at 0x40002000. > > I2C#0 is already mapped at 0x40021000. > > Remove the invalid mapping added in commits aecfbbc97a2 & 394c8bbfb7a. I wonder why I thought there was something at 0x40002000 ? The data sheet per the URL in commit 394c8bbfb7 certainly doesn't list anything there. Maybe I misread 0x40020000 at some point... Reviewed-by: Peter Maydell <peter.maydell@linaro.org> thanks -- PMM
